摘要
用高频熔炼的方法配制了三个稀土金属间化合物即 (K ,M ,N) .采用X射线衍射法测定了它们的晶体结构 ,结果表明 :K(NdAl1 .75Si0 .2 5)属于立方晶系 ,点阵参数a =7.986× 10 - 1 0 m ;化合物M(NdAl2 Si2 )和N(NdAl1 .2 5Si0 .75)是六方晶系 ,其点阵参数分别为a =4.2 3× 10 - 1 0 m、c =6.71× 10 - 1 0 m ,N和a =4.2 76× 10 - 1 0 m、c =4.2 0 4× 10 - 1 0 m .
This paper presents the invenstigation on the structure of three compounds in Al-Nd-Si ternary system .Three compounds are synthesized by high frenquency melthing methods,namely K(NdAl 1.75 Si 0.25 ),M(NdAl 2 Si 2 and N(NdAl 1.25 Si 0.75 ).The crystalline structure of three compounds was investgated by X-ray diffraction. The results show that the compound K is cubic with a =7.986×10 -10 m,the intermetallic compound M and N is hexagonal with a =4.23×10 -10 m ? c =6.17×10 -10 m and a =4.276×10 -10 m? c =4.204×10 -10 m,resperctively.
